The-famous-theatrical-partner--| ship between Jack Hulbert and Paul Murray has suddenly been terrhinuted.

The partnership has lasted eight or nine years, and during that time Mr. Hulbert and Mr. Murray have produced only six shows, four of them being revues and two musical comedies.

+

These shows have all had very good runs, with the exception of "Follow a Star" one of the musical plecea.

They started with the revue "By the Way," which they afterwards produced in America, and followed this up with the musical comedy "Lido Lady."

Then they produced the.

revue "Clowns in Clover" and "The House That Jack Built," and then came the musical play "Follow a Star," fol- lowed by the highly successful revue, "Folly to be Wise, which is still ruming t the Piccadilly Theatre.

Mr. J. Hulbert spoke with some emotion regarding the ending of the partnership.

"Paul Murray and I" he said, "have been big pals,-a swell as bus!- ness associates, for such a long time that I feel I cannot go into details regarding the reason for the termination of the partnership.

"I shall continue in management; and the running of "Folly to be Wise" will take up a lot of my time. "I have also contracted to do two talkies, and I have a lot of wireless engagements in front of me. ..I am partnered by my brother, Claud. An Unlucky Blow for Mr. Edgar Wallace.

Mr. Will Hays_the_“dictator" of. the American film business, has put ban on gangster stories for tulkies.

Welcome as this news will be to the British film-goer who is satiated with crime talkles, the decision strikes an unfortunate blow at a most interesting British-American scheme to film Mr. Edgar Wallace's famous play "On the Spot." The United States produces 95 per cent. of the world's supply of pictures.

The picture industry is the fourth largest of all the industries in the United States.

Captain in Coast (Hollywood and district) Studio Properties 18 £16,000,000..

Estimated American production schedule for the current year, £40,000,000.

The number of people employed in the industry In America, $75,000,

Six billion lineal feet of film are manufactured and used annually.

About 25,000 miles of film pass through the American film ex- changes each day.

15,000 picture advertisements are placed daily in various media, and the annual cost

of motion picture publicity is £20,000,000.

The weekly picture attendance in the United States is 115,000,000, out of a world total of 250,000,000.

Gross takings in American cinemas yearly are £312,000,000.

FILM CENSORSHIP.

Australia Denies Anti-

British Bias.

In his annual report to the Minister of Trade and Customs the Chief Film Censor at Melbourne, Mr. Cresswell O'Reilly, denies that in Hollywood by arrangement, with in banning films he has been actuat- the London Galusborough and Bri- ed by anti-British blas. tish Lion film concerns..
